Business In Elmbridge

Elmbridge has a thriving local economy. It has been the business base for a number of household name companies for some years. There are a number of large commercial estates including Brooklands Industrial Park, The Heights Business Park and the Molesey and Hersham Industrial Estates. There are also many smaller businesses and a variety of independent traders and retailers.

|Business Rates
The Non-Domestic Rates, or Business Rates, collected by local councils are the means by which businesses and others who occupy non-domestic property make a contribution towards the cost of local services.

|Elmbridge Civic Improvement Fund
ECIF has been established to improve environmental and business projects within Elmbridge that benefit the local economy and attract the public to local services and amenities via a grant system.
